Discover the exhilarating adventures of Tom Cole in 'Hell West and Crooked', a bestselling memoir that immerses readers in the untamed Australian outback of the 1920s and 1930s. This remarkable biography details Tom's life as a drover and stockman in some of Australia’s toughest terrains, showcasing the raw, unfiltered experiences of a real-life legend akin to Crocodile Dundee. With humor and drama, the author recounts his thrilling escapades as a buffalo shooter and crocodile hunter in the Northern Territory before the war, making it an essential read for lovers of true adventure and Australian history. First published in 1988, 'Hell West and Crooked' has captivated more than 100,000 readers, bringing to life a bygone era with vivid storytelling.
